Description

The Phidgets Graphic LCD Phidget is a compact 128 × 64-pixel graphic display for showing text and simple graphics. It connects to a VINT Hub via a 3-wire Phidget cable – with no complex electronics required.

Backlight brightness and pixel contrast can both be controlled from software. The display can draw individual pixels, lines and rectangles, write text in three different fonts (or load your own bitmap fonts) and store up to three frames so screen regions can be copied easily.

Programming is handled through the Phidget22 library and is supported on common operating systems (Windows, macOS, Linux, iOS, Android) as well as numerous programming languages (C, C#, Python, Java, JavaScript, Swift and more).

Technical data

Controlled by VINT
Driver support Phidget22
Max. VINT communication speed 1 Mbit/s
Screen resolution 128 × 64 pixels
LCD refresh rate 5 Hz
Pixel size 450 µm (0.45 mm)
Current consumption min. 295 µA
Current consumption max. 60 mA
Operating temperature -20 to 70 °C

Scope of delivery

  • 1× Phidgets Graphic LCD Phidget (LCD1100_1)

Note: Operation additionally requires a VINT Hub (e.g. HUB0000 series) and a Phidget cable – both are not included and available separately.
